Roads blocked ahead of Pope’s arrival.

Areas where Pope Francis will be visiting are
on lock down. Namugongo Martyrs Shrines are
still closed to the Public with heavy police and
army deployment.
Many roads will stay closed around
Namugongo, Mbuya and Entebbe road. The
Stretch from Kyaliwajjala leading to
Namugongo Martyrs Shrine is currently blocked
to Motorists and Entebbe road will particularly
be closed from 4pm to 10pm. On Sunday
when the Pope will depart from Uganda.
